how to slow walk marvel rivals
You slow walk in Marvel Rivals by barely tilting the movement stick on a controller; on native keyboard/mouse there is no built‑in slow‑walk key, so you need a controller or a custom workaround.
How to Slow Walk – Quick Steps
On controller (console or PC)
- Lightly push the left analog stick forward instead of fully tilting it.
- The less you push, the slower your character moves; more pressure = closer to a full run.
- You can do the same in any direction (forward, backward, strafing left/right) by gently tilting toward that direction.
Think of it like a “pressure throttle”: tiny tilt = casual slow walk, halfway = jog, full tilt = sprint.
On keyboard and mouse (default game)
- The game currently does not offer a native slow‑walk key for standard keyboard movement; tapping W just gives you short bursts, not a true steady slow walk.
- To truly slow walk on PC without a controller, players use:
- A controller plugged into PC and mapped alongside mouse aiming, or
- External scripts/mods that bind a “walk” speed to a key (for example, a popular PC script lets you hold a chosen key like Alt or Ctrl to walk more slowly and use W/A/S/D to move, adjusting speed with the mouse wheel).
Always check game rules and anti‑cheat policies before using any external tools or scripts.
